Small-business owners making their first promo tend to value FlexClip's simplicity: an easy video maker with basic AI tools at $10-$30/month, no design background required — though free exports carry a watermark and top out around one minute.
Designers see it differently, because Canva Video extends a platform they already work in daily: Magic Studio AI on tap, unlimited video length, a watermark-free free tier, and Free / $15/month covering the paid layer.

FlexClip is a beginner-friendly video maker with drag-and-drop simplicity. It is ideal for small businesses and individuals new to video creation.
Canva Video extends the popular design platform into video creation. It is perfect for users already in the Canva ecosystem who need quick branded videos.
FlexClip starts at $10-$30/month, while Canva Video offers Free / $15/month. Consider your budget and required features when choosing.
FlexClip is optimized for small businesses, beginners. Canva Video excels with designers, social media managers. Choose based on your primary use case.
Canva Video offers watermark-free exports on the free tier, giving you professional results without payment. FlexClip adds watermarks to free exports.
FlexClip offers Basic AI tools with 1 min free video length. Canva Video provides Magic Studio AI with Unlimited video length.
